After the retreat: Where do I go from here?

Here are a few suggestions for your continued discernment:

If you are feeling drawn to a particular congregation:

Spend time with the Sisters, so that you will get to know them, and they will get to know you.

Time spent getting to know each other is essential in helping both you and the congregation to decide whether or not this is a good "fit" for you.

Ask questions about their mission.

  Ask yourself if you have the gifts needed for the life and the work of these sisters.

If it seems that you don't, talk to the Sisters about it.  It may be that they see in you gifts that you don't see, or that they don't view the gifts you lack as essential to their mission. 

On the other hand, God may be calling you in a different direction.

Ask yourself if you feel at home with these sisters.

Remember that you are not the only one discerning your call. The religious congregation also must discern.

Pray every day.

Find an experienced spiritual director to help you listen to how God is working in your heart.

 

If you do not have a particular congregation in mind:

Find an experienced spiritual director to accompany you in your discernment.

Check out various congregations. 

Visit the "Links to Explore" page.

Talk to Sisters in your area or from congregations whose mission attracts you.  Ask questions about their life and their mission.

Call the vocation director for your diocese.

Pray every day.

Always remember that, as a living work of art, you are in process!  Don't expect to be complete any time soon!
